Natural Childbirth Promotes Good Mothering

Wow! I was just over at Science Codex and I read about a new study in The Journal of Child Psychology and Psychiatry, about the effects of natural childbirth (in this study, vaginal birth) vs. cesarean birth on a mother’s responsiveness to her baby.  The study measured the brain activity of mothers who birthed vaginally vs. those who birthed by cesarean, and found that the mothers who birthed vaginally were much more responsive to their babies’ cries.

They also found that the mothers who birthed by cesarean were at a much higher risk for developing postpartum depression.  A mother suffering from postpartum depression would be much less capable of caring for her infant successfully.  Studies have shown that babies of mothers suffering from postpartum depression often suffer developmentally, emotionally and behaviorally due to a poor bond with their mothers.
